[Source] It is the resin in the heartwood of the Santalum album plant of the Santalaceae family.

[Original morphology] The plant morphology is detailed in the "Sandalwood" entry.

【Functions and indications】 "Supplement to Compendium of Materia Medica": "It treats stomach qi stagnation and pain, liver depression and discomfort."

【Excerpt】 《*Dictionary》

[Source] From "Supplement to Compendium of Materia Medica". "Gangmu Taiyi" says: Sandalwood mud is the fat contained in the heart of sandalwood, which is not easy to obtain. Its color is like dust, so it is named mud. When hot, it also smells like sandalwood.
